Garden Club of America Fellowship in Ecological Restoration

Description

The Garden Club of America Fellowship in Ecological Restoration restoration supports specialized study and research in ecological restoration, the "active healing of the land." Thorough study and research will assist the recovery and management of ecological integrity, through increased understanding of a critical range of variability in biodiversity, ecological processes, structures, regional and historical context, and/or sustainable cultural practices. The goal of this fellowship is to support research that will advance knowledge and increase the numbers of scientists in this important field. The grant is awarded annually to exceptional graduate students to support specialized study in ecological restoration at an accredited U.S. university. Preference will be given to projects that include field research conducted in the United States. Recognizing that the field of ecological restoration can be studied in a variety of degree programs, the Fellowship is not limited to a specific degree. Fields of study of past recipients have ranged from forestry to applied plant sciences to ecology and evolutionary biology. Applicants must also submit a letter of endorsement written by the applicant's graduate faculty advisor. The letter must include a statement that the applicant is properly enrolled in graduate school. One additional letter of recommendation is also required.
